
AFCON: PESEIRO MAINTAINS SAME FORMATION AS OMERUO, ARIBO, SIMON START VS GUINEA-BISSAU
Super Eagles head coach Jose Peseiro has named four new players in his starting line-up for Monday’s (today) Group A with the Djurtus of Guinea-Bissau.
Peseiro also opted for a 3-4-3 formation for the clash billed for the Felix Houphouet Boigny Stadium.
Stanley Nwabali will start in goal for the third consecutive game in the competition.
Fenerbahce’s Bright Osayi-Samuel will make his first start of the game. He will play at right wing-back, while Ola Aina will play at left wing-back.
Kenneth Omeruo will take the place of the injured William Troost-Ekong in starting line-up.
Omeruo will pair Semi Ajayi and Calvin Bassey in central defence.
Frank Onyeka, Joe Aribo and will take charge of midfield.
Moses Simon and Samuel Chukwueze will play from the wings, while Victor Osimhen will lead the attack.
